In the group in this paper,we study the hips swivel 180 degrees took control of Vincent"action,it is belong to the difficulty of movement in a dynamic force action,the score of 0.8 points,the difficulty score is higher,and it is difficult to correctly grasp the action briefly summarized as:push,push,lift,turn,stretch,pendulum,bent arm buffer and control the core technology,each technical links are mutual connection,mutual influence,can not be separated.Hip action in the set of exercises which use rate is very high,especially in the high level of competition is particularly prominent,this action hip action in the most difficult,usually,only the master athletes to correct Into it.In this paper,literature review and expert interviews,video analysis,three-dimensional force measurement,statistics,comparative analysis and AHP(analytic hierarchy process)method of study for the Wuhan Institute of physical education students,national excellent athlete Peng and Yan.Experiment to two platform JVC camera and three dimensional measuring force platform for synchronization test,through three dimensional kinematics analytical and the three dimensional measuring force platform dynamics analysis,get aerobics athletes completed "mention hip up swivel 180 degrees received control Vincent" of movement biological mechanical parameter,which selected Peng a and strict a success of the once action,and strict a failed of a times action of technology details parameter,in Yu Lianghua on the gymnastics action structure model and technology deviation of adjustment and on the gymnastics technology two article articles based Shang,on "Mention hip up swivel 180 degrees received control Vincent "action again established has structure model,and find two bit athletes action technology of pros and cons and different of technology features and performance form,according to new action structure model,using movement biological mechanical of research method on action technology details for quantitative analysis,reveals its punches mechanism,description its movement features,analysis two bit athletes completed action of not reasonable technology,to find effect action completed of important factors,established right of action structure model,Enable more players to a high quality master the movement.Finally,use the AHP(analytic hierarchy process)Act "hip swivel 180 degrees then charged Vincent" movement structure model in qualitative and quantitative analysis of the issues,get athletes finished the overall quality score,and thus a set is both reasonable and simple method of quantitative evaluation of the quality of the action completes,the impact on improving quality of movement is very important.By analyzing the results,draw the following conclusions:Through the analysis of the results,the following conclusions are drawn:1,the action structure model is built on the basis of the each stage technique between distinct,between them are interrelated,mutual influence,form a unified body.This to complete,accurate diagnosis and analysis of technical movement has a important significance.Technical details of quantitative analysis,which can derive the corresponding level subsystem technology to complete the quality,and affect other technology normal problems.2,tart stage of technology and technical details of quantitative analysis showed that the connection and grasp the rhythm of the buffering time is too long is not conducive to the latter part of the action;small thrust is one of the reasons that leads to the failure of the action;swivel mainly to the head,body or shoulder drive;a strict bent arm technology for advanced technology,Peng a hip technology for advanced technology.3,vacated stage of technology and technical details of quantitative analysis showed that if the minimum of left and right hip joint angle greater than(107.9125 degrees,65.5174 DEG)and maximum center of gravity height below 0.4237m,flight time short to 0.0834s,whole action is difficult to complete;Peng a hip accept the hip technology for advanced technology,strict a successful action performance is correct,which appeared in the make up of technology.4,landing stage of technology and technical details of the quantitative analysis shows that successfully complete the movement of the left and right shoulder velocity value should be controlled separately between the 0.8528?1.5347m/s 0.9780?1.2877m/s.The change of the height of the center of gravity value should be controlled between the 0.3006-0.4077m,center of gravity speed change value should be controlled between the 0.3261?0.9354m/s and reasonable scope of the buffer time should be in control of more than 1.4178s and right toe maximum speed of at least to achieve 4.1m/s.5,from the point of view of movement quality evaluation results in AHP method,computer weighing action model quantitative analysis data,objectively to athletes completed action force of rationality,technology and technical details between mutual connection scoring.Two athletes completed the quality problem of the action is close to it and the empirical judgment basically.
